+-- | A record of the basic operations that are necessary to build a synchronisation processor.
+data SyncProcessor i a m = SyncProcessor
+    { syncProcessorDeleteMany :: Set i -> m () -- ^ Delete the items with an identifier in the given set.
+    , syncProcessorQuerySynced :: Set i -> m (Set i) -- ^ Query the identifiers of the items that are in store, of the given set.
+    , syncProcessorQueryNewRemote :: Set i -> m (Set (Synced i a)) -- ^ Query the items that are in store, but not in the given set.
+    , syncProcessorInsertMany :: Set (Synced i a) -> m () -- ^ Insert a set of items into the stor.
+    } deriving (Generic)
+
+-- | Process a server-side synchronisation request using a custom synchronisation processor
+--
+-- WARNING: The identifier generation function must produce newly unique identifiers such that each new item gets a unique identifier.
+--
+-- You can use this function with deterministically-random identifiers or incrementing identifiers.
+processSyncCustom ::
+       forall i a m. (Ord i, Ord a, Monad m)
+    => m i
+    -> UTCTime
+    -> SyncProcessor i a m
+    -> SyncRequest i a
+    -> m (SyncResponse i a)
+processSyncCustom genUuid now SyncProcessor {..} SyncRequest {..} = do
+    deleteUndeleted
+        -- First we delete the items that were deleted locally but not yet remotely.
+        -- Then we find the items that have been deleted remotely but not locally
+    deletedRemotely <- syncItemsToBeDeletedLocally
+        -- Then we find the items that have appeared remotely but aren't known locally
+    newRemoteItems <- syncNewRemoteItems
+        -- Then we add the items that should be added.
+    newLocalItems <- syncAddedItems
+    pure
+        SyncResponse
+            { syncResponseNewRemoteItems = newRemoteItems
+            , syncResponseAddedItems = newLocalItems
+            , syncResponseItemsToBeDeletedLocally = deletedRemotely
+            }
+  where
+    deleteUndeleted :: m ()
+    deleteUndeleted = syncProcessorDeleteMany syncRequestUndeletedItems
+    syncItemsToBeDeletedLocally :: m (Set i)
+    syncItemsToBeDeletedLocally = do
+        foundItems <- syncProcessorQuerySynced syncRequestSyncedItems
+        pure $ syncRequestSyncedItems `S.difference` foundItems
+    syncNewRemoteItems :: m (Set (Synced i a))
+    syncNewRemoteItems = syncProcessorQueryNewRemote syncRequestSyncedItems
+    syncAddedItems :: m (Set (Synced i a))
+    syncAddedItems = do
+        is <-
+            fmap S.fromList $
+            forM (S.toList syncRequestAddedItems) $ \Added {..} -> do
+                uuid <- genUuid
+                pure
+                    Synced
+                        { syncedUuid = uuid
+                        , syncedCreated = addedCreated
+                        , syncedSynced = now
+                        , syncedValue = addedValue
+                        }
+        syncProcessorInsertMany is
+        pure is
+
